Montana holds off Northern Iowa 20-14 in FCS showdown

CEDAR FALLS, Iowa (AP) — Jerry Louie-McGee returned a punt 81 yards for a touchdown in the second quarter and Montana held on to defeat Northern Iowa 20-14 on Saturday in a matchup of FCS powers. Brady Gustafson hit Josh Horner for a 34-yard score and Tim Semenza kicked two field goals for the Grizzlies (2-0), all in the first half.

Tyvis Smith, who had 130 yards, scored on a 1-yard touchdown plunge in the first quarter and Daurice Fountain hauled in a 28-yard pass from Aaron Bailey with 8:01 remaining to give the Panthers (1-1) a chance.

Northern Iowa, which beat Iowa State last week, had 351 yards to 206 for Montana, but also had two turnovers and was 6 of 19 on third down and 0 for 3 on fourth. The Grizzlies only had 70 yards in the second half but didn’t have a turnover. Northern Iowa forced Iowa State into four turnovers in its 25-20 win.
